The album opens with Beethoven's iconic Symphony No. 6 in F Major, Op. 68, affectionately known as the "Pastoral." This symphony is a vivid musical depiction of the countryside, with each of its five movements painting a different scene: the cheerful village life, a bubbling brook, a lively peasant dance, a thunderstorm, and a joyful shepherd's song.
